Curriculum

The Academy of Cosmetology, Inc. offers a 2000 hour, 14 month course in the field of Cosmetology. Your career as a Cosmetologist will bring you in direct contact with the public. Your work will require you to touch the hair, skin, and nails of your clients. Upon graduation, the student has the opportunity to be employed in the field of Cosmetology choosing to do hair, skin or nails as a licensed professional.

COURSE OF STUDY
The following subjects will be covered in Practical and Theory during your course of study:

Manicuring 125 HOURS
Esthetics 150 HOURS
Salon Management 150 HOURS
Instructors Discretion 500 HOURS
Hairstyling 260 HOURS
Haircutting 205 HOURS
Chemical Services 530 HOURS
Chem, Bacteriology, Anatomy, Sanitation, Skin&Nails, Disease/Disorders   80 HOURS

Students will spend their first 300+ hours in Basics classes and the remaining 1,700 hours will be spent on the clinic floor in all phases of the Cosmetology course of study.
